A language exemption is an entry-requirement decision, not extra CAO points. Apply to the body responsible for the requirement. For NUI institutions, the handbook directs applicants to NUI; other institutions have their own procedures. CAO Handbook 2027, printed page 19.
Irish and a third language are different requirements
An exemption from Irish does not automatically remove a third-language requirement. The answer depends on the exemption grounds and the course. NUI publishes separate grounds covering birth or education outside Ireland, learning difficulties and other circumstances. Read the ground that actually applies to you rather than treating another student's exemption as a precedent. NUI language exemptions.
A school exemption from studying Irish and an NUI matriculation exemption serve different purposes. An NUI exemption is also separate from DARE eligibility; applying to one does not apply to the other. NUI language exemptions.
How to apply and record the decision
Use the official NUI exemption application portal for an NUI exemption. Its current instructions require online submission, not a postal application. Follow the documentary requirements for the selected ground.
For a non-NUI institution, contact its Admissions Office about the exemption you need. CAO's handbook says approved exemptions become visible in the Qualifications and Assessment section from early March. Handbook, printed page 19.
Check the approval in May
When the Check and Confirm email arrives, inspect the exemption entry. If an exemption granted by NUI, TCD, MI or UL is missing, notify the institution that granted it immediately. Keep the approval and your application details together so you can identify the mismatch. Handbook, printed page 19.
Do not assume “I submitted the form” means “the exemption has been granted”. Check the actual decision and the course requirement it covers.
A useful distinction before choosing courses
Suppose a course has a language requirement and you believe an exemption may apply. First confirm the course rule and the appropriate exemption route; then check the evidence and approval. Separately calculate your points. Removing an entry condition does not increase that number or promise an offer.
For qualifications from outside Ireland, the correct matriculation rules may differ. Read international qualifications and contact the college rather than automatically using a Leaving Certificate exemption form.
